- The distance between Kitamiesashi, Japan and Isfjord Radio, Svalbard, Norway is approximately 5,916 km or 3,676 mi.
- To reach Kitamiesashi in this distance one would set out from Isfjord Radio, Svalbard bearing 43.4° or NE and follow the great circles arc to approach Kitamiesashi bearing 168.4° or SSE .
- Kitamiesashi has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b) whereas Isfjord Radio, Svalbard has a tundra climate (ET).
- Kitamiesashi is in or near the boreal wet forest biome whereas Isfjord Radio, Svalbard is in or near the polar desert biome.
- The mean annual temperature is 9.5 °C (17.1°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 8.3 °C (14.9°F) more in Kitamiesashi.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 900.1 mm (35.4 in) more which is equivalent to 900.1 l/m² (22.09 US gal/ft²) or 9,001,000 l/ha (962,267 US gal/ac) more. About 3 2/3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 33.1° higher in Kitamiesashi than in Isfjord Radio, Svalbard.
- Relative humidity levels are 5.2% lower.
- The mean dew point temperature is 8.3°C (14.9°F) higher.
